About Aaron Robinson

Aaron Robinson is a Senior Learning and Development Specialist at Cvent, where he has worked since 2021. He has a background in quality assurance and customer success, with previous roles at Cvent and DP Clinical Inc., and holds an MBA from Marymount University.

Current Role at Cvent

Aaron Robinson serves as a Senior Learning and Development Specialist at Cvent, a position he has held since 2021. In this role, he focuses on enhancing employee learning experiences through the Learning Management System. He integrates various training tools, including videos and courses, to improve the effectiveness of training programs. Additionally, he coordinates internal training sessions, managing logistical details such as scheduling and material preparation.

Previous Experience at Cvent

Before his current role, Aaron Robinson held several positions at Cvent. He worked as a Project Manager for Virtual and Hybrid Events in 2020, and as a Senior Customer Success Advisor for Enterprise Accounts from 2018 to 2019. He also served as a Senior Client Success Consultant for Mid-Market accounts from 2016 to 2018 and as a Senior Strategic Initiatives Business Analyst in the PMO from 2019 to 2020. His diverse roles contributed to his understanding of customer success and project management within the company.

Training Program Development

In his current role, Aaron Robinson plays a key role in evaluating the effectiveness of training programs at Cvent. He provides feedback to management and leadership to enhance training outcomes. Additionally, he assists in developing new testing and assessment processes aimed at better evaluating employee skills and training effectiveness. He is also involved in the development and presentation of product training for employees across Cvent's US and India offices through Cvent University.
